FULLY FUNDED GHENT UNIVERSITY MASTER MIND SCHOLARSHIP 2026 IN BELGIUM
Applications are now open for the prestigious Ghent University Master Mind Scholarship 2026, a fully funded opportunity designed for outstanding international students seeking to pursue a Master's degree in Belgium. This scholarship provides a gateway to world-class education, enabling scholars to advance their academic careers while experiencing one of Europe's most dynamic and innovative learning environments.
The scholarship is hosted by Ghent University and funded by the Government of Flanders. Established in 1817, Ghent University is globally recognized for excellence in research and innovation, consistently ranking among the top 100 universities worldwide. Through the Master Mind program, these institutions aim to attract top international talent and promote global academic collaboration.
SCHOLARSHIP BENEFITS
The Master Mind Scholarship offers a comprehensive financial package, including:
- Annual grant of €10,225
- Full tuition fee waiver
- Accommodation support in Ghent
- Contribution toward living expenses and insurance
- Opportunity to work up to 20 hours per week during the academic term
ELIGIBILITY CRITERIA
To qualify for the scholarship, applicants must meet the following requirements:
- Must be a non-Belgian (international) student
- Hold a Bachelor's degree from a recognized institution
- Minimum CGPA of 3.5 out of 4.0
- Meet all admission requirements for a Master's program at Ghent University
- Provide proof of English proficiency (e.g., TOEFL or IELTS)

- Must not have previously studied in Belgium (except exchange programs)
AVAILABLE PROGRAMS
Applicants can choose from a wide range of Master's degree programs offered at Ghent University across disciplines such as:
- Science and Engineering
- Health and Life Sciences
- Social Sciences
- Business and Economics
- Arts and Humanities
REQUIRED DOCUMENTS
Applicants must prepare and submit the following documents:
- Academic transcripts and certificates
- Bachelor's degree diploma
- Proof of English language proficiency
- Copy of passport
- Updated CV/Resume
- Motivation letter
